In order to justify converting a Bul- lard, rather than buying a new machine outright, Blaschke said CPS must deliver an Elec-trol for less than 75% of the cost of a new machine. “That’s the tipping point where they might go new,” Blaschke said, depend- ing on the lead times of new equipment, which can be 12–18 months. But once a manufacturer decides to go with an Elec-trol over a new machine, they should fi nd a dependable machine and a piece of history.


Aside from owning a part of one of the “last large machine tools manufac- tured in the US,” Blaschke said, the re- manufactured Bullard will “run another 20 years.” ME
